The skin, which is the largest organ of the human body, can be subject to various diseases and formations. Skin growths, such as moles (nevi), lipomas, atheromas, can occur for various reasons and, depending on their nature, may require surgical removal.

Indications for surgical removal:

Surgical excision of growths may be recommended for various medical and cosmetic reasons. Typical indications for removal:

  • Cosmetic or aesthetic reasons: Some growths can cause discomfort due to their size, shape, or location. Removal of such neoplasms can improve the appearance and psychological comfort of the patient.
  • Discomfort or complications: moles, lipomas, atheromas can become a source of complications, such as inflammatory processes or bleeding. Removal of such neoplasms can prevent further complications and preserve the patient’s health.
  • Diagnostic purposes: In some cases, removal may be necessary for diagnostic tests or analyzes, for example, if a skin lesion during dermatoscopy raises doubts, then its removal can help the doctor perform a biopsy and establish an accurate diagnosis.

Surgical removals at the Mediostar clinic are performed under local anesthesia on an outpatient basis, after suturing you can go home.

 Preparing for surgical removal of skin tumors in Lviv

Preparing for surgical removal of skin tumors includes several steps that will help ensure a successful operation and a quick recovery after it. Here are some recommendations:

  • Consultation with a doctor: A preliminary meeting with a dermatologist or surgeon to evaluate the skin tumor and discuss a treatment plan. The doctor will talk about the removal procedure, possible risks and benefits, and answer all your questions.
  • Determining the removal method: The doctor will determine the best method for removing the skin tumor depending on its size, type, and location.
  • Stopping taking medications or supplements, such as aspirin or fish oil supplements, that can affect blood clotting. Follow all your doctor’s recommendations regarding stopping medication before surgery.

A mole should not be surgically removed in the following cases:

  • Chronic diseases in the acute stage.
  • Infectious diseases.
  • Skin diseases at the site of exposure.
  • Skin diseases and inflammatory diseases in the area of ​​the procedure.
  • Epilepsy.
  • Cyclovascular disorders.
  • An increase in body temperature, which indicates a virus or inflammatory process in the body.

Rehabilitation period after surgical removal of a mole (nevus), atheroma, or lipoma

To make the wound heal faster and the scar less noticeable, you must follow the recommended care after surgical removal of neoplasms. Among the mandatorydressing procedures:

  • With clean hands, you need to clean the wound with a gauze swab with chlorhexidine.
  • Dry the removal site with a dry, clean paper towel.
  • Apply a thin layer of ointment or powder with an antibiotic prescribed by your doctor to the wound.
  • Cover the area with a clean bandage.
  • Fix the bandage on the skin.

The stitches are removed after 7 days. In general, the healing stage can take a month. For the first 7-10 days, you cannot wet the wound, you are not allowed to take a bath, visit the pool. It is strictly forbidden to visit the sauna, bathhouse. You must completely abandon visiting the solarium, since ultraviolet radiation provokes melanoma.
